diff options
Diffstat (limited to 'dsf-gdb/org.eclipse.cdt.dsf.gdb/src/org/eclipse/cdt/dsf/gdb')
5 files changed, 5 insertions, 7 deletions
diff --git a/dsf-gdb/org.eclipse.cdt.dsf.gdb/src/org/eclipse/cdt/dsf/gdb/launching/GdbLaunch.java b/dsf-gdb/org.eclipse.cdt.dsf.gdb/src/org/eclipse/cdt/dsf/gdb/launching/GdbLaunch.java index dd8eae54daf..fc302e776de 100644 --- a/dsf-gdb/org.eclipse.cdt.dsf.gdb/src/org/eclipse/cdt/dsf/gdb/launching/GdbLaunch.java +++ b/dsf-gdb/org.eclipse.cdt.dsf.gdb/src/org/eclipse/cdt/dsf/gdb/launching/GdbLaunch.java @@ -92,9 +92,7 @@ import org.eclipse.debug.core.IStatusHandler; import org.eclipse.debug.core.commands.IDebugCommandRequest; import org.eclipse.debug.core.commands.IDisconnectHandler; import org.eclipse.debug.core.commands.ITerminateHandler; -import org.eclipse.debug.core.model.IDisconnect; import org.eclipse.debug.core.model.ISourceLocator; -import org.eclipse.debug.core.model.ITerminate; import org.eclipse.launchbar.core.target.ILaunchTarget; import org.eclipse.launchbar.core.target.launch.ITargetedLaunch; @@ -102,7 +100,7 @@ import org.eclipse.launchbar.core.target.launch.ITargetedLaunch; * The only object in the model that implements the traditional interfaces. */ @ThreadSafe -public class GdbLaunch extends DsfLaunch implements ITerminate, IDisconnect, ITracedLaunch, ITargetedLaunch { +public class GdbLaunch extends DsfLaunch implements ITracedLaunch, ITargetedLaunch { private DefaultDsfExecutor fExecutor; private DsfSession fSession; private DsfServicesTracker fTracker; diff --git a/dsf-gdb/org.eclipse.cdt.dsf.gdb/src/org/eclipse/cdt/dsf/gdb/service/GDBHardwareAndOS_7_5.java b/dsf-gdb/org.eclipse.cdt.dsf.gdb/src/org/eclipse/cdt/dsf/gdb/service/GDBHardwareAndOS_7_5.java index ac79b7251c2..dd377c11b02 100644 --- a/dsf-gdb/org.eclipse.cdt.dsf.gdb/src/org/eclipse/cdt/dsf/gdb/service/GDBHardwareAndOS_7_5.java +++ b/dsf-gdb/org.eclipse.cdt.dsf.gdb/src/org/eclipse/cdt/dsf/gdb/service/GDBHardwareAndOS_7_5.java @@ -32,7 +32,7 @@ import org.eclipse.core.runtime.Status; /** * @since 4.2 */ -public class GDBHardwareAndOS_7_5 extends GDBHardwareAndOS implements IGDBHardwareAndOS2 { +public class GDBHardwareAndOS_7_5 extends GDBHardwareAndOS { public GDBHardwareAndOS_7_5(DsfSession session) { super(session); diff --git a/dsf-gdb/org.eclipse.cdt.dsf.gdb/src/org/eclipse/cdt/dsf/gdb/service/GDBRunControl_7_0_NS.java b/dsf-gdb/org.eclipse.cdt.dsf.gdb/src/org/eclipse/cdt/dsf/gdb/service/GDBRunControl_7_0_NS.java index fd2afcd16d0..72dd8b38dcc 100644 --- a/dsf-gdb/org.eclipse.cdt.dsf.gdb/src/org/eclipse/cdt/dsf/gdb/service/GDBRunControl_7_0_NS.java +++ b/dsf-gdb/org.eclipse.cdt.dsf.gdb/src/org/eclipse/cdt/dsf/gdb/service/GDBRunControl_7_0_NS.java @@ -164,7 +164,7 @@ public class GDBRunControl_7_0_NS extends AbstractDsfService */ @Immutable private static class RunControlEvent<V extends IDMContext, T extends MIEvent<? extends IDMContext>> - extends AbstractDMEvent<V> implements IDMEvent<V>, IMIDMEvent { + extends AbstractDMEvent<V> implements IMIDMEvent { final private T fMIInfo; public RunControlEvent(V dmc, T miInfo) { diff --git a/dsf-gdb/org.eclipse.cdt.dsf.gdb/src/org/eclipse/cdt/dsf/gdb/service/command/GDBControl_7_2.java b/dsf-gdb/org.eclipse.cdt.dsf.gdb/src/org/eclipse/cdt/dsf/gdb/service/command/GDBControl_7_2.java index ea8fd5d18b8..3e5ca0e99cd 100644 --- a/dsf-gdb/org.eclipse.cdt.dsf.gdb/src/org/eclipse/cdt/dsf/gdb/service/command/GDBControl_7_2.java +++ b/dsf-gdb/org.eclipse.cdt.dsf.gdb/src/org/eclipse/cdt/dsf/gdb/service/command/GDBControl_7_2.java @@ -26,7 +26,7 @@ import org.eclipse.debug.core.ILaunchConfiguration; * Turn on the use of the --thread-group option for GDB 7.2 * @since 4.0 */ -public class GDBControl_7_2 extends GDBControl_7_0 implements IGDBControl { +public class GDBControl_7_2 extends GDBControl_7_0 { public GDBControl_7_2(DsfSession session, ILaunchConfiguration config, CommandFactory factory) { super(session, config, factory); setUseThreadGroupOptions(true); diff --git a/dsf-gdb/org.eclipse.cdt.dsf.gdb/src/org/eclipse/cdt/dsf/gdb/service/command/GDBControl_7_4.java b/dsf-gdb/org.eclipse.cdt.dsf.gdb/src/org/eclipse/cdt/dsf/gdb/service/command/GDBControl_7_4.java index 2f61fd4799d..63eb17285f2 100644 --- a/dsf-gdb/org.eclipse.cdt.dsf.gdb/src/org/eclipse/cdt/dsf/gdb/service/command/GDBControl_7_4.java +++ b/dsf-gdb/org.eclipse.cdt.dsf.gdb/src/org/eclipse/cdt/dsf/gdb/service/command/GDBControl_7_4.java @@ -31,7 +31,7 @@ import org.eclipse.debug.core.ILaunchConfiguration; * * @since 4.1 */ -public class GDBControl_7_4 extends GDBControl_7_2 implements IGDBControl { +public class GDBControl_7_4 extends GDBControl_7_2 { /** * A command control context that is also a IBreakpointsTargetDMContext |